Vacshack Inc
Closed
12409 N Rockwell Ave
Oklahoma City, OK 73142
Vacshack Inc is a vibrant retail shop located in the heart of Oklahoma City, OK. Specializing in a wide range of vacuum cleaners and accessories, it offers customers expert advice and quality products to meet their cleaning needs. With a friendly atmosphere and knowledgeable staff, Vacshack Inc is the go-to destination for anyone looking to keep their space spotless.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.


